A $525 Million+ Global Launch is in the Cards for Zootopia 2
Current worldwide projections put Zootopia 2 on track to gross around $500-525 million in its first weekend, a monumental figure for any release, but particularly for an animated film. Only a handful of titles in box office history have ever crossed the $500M global opening threshold, placing the Disney sequel in truly elite company.
If these numbers hold, Zootopia 2 would surpass many superhero tentpoles and franchise giants, becoming one of the largest global openings in cinema history.
Top 10 Biggest Global Opening Weekends Currently:
- Avengers: Endgame ≈ US$ 1.22 billion
- Avengers: Infinity War ≈ US$ 640 million
- Spider-Man: No Way Home ≈ US$ 601 million
- The Fate of the Furious ≈ US$ 541 million
- Star Wars: The Force Awakens ≈ US$ 528 million
- Jurassic World ≈ US$ 525 million
-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ows – Part 2 ≈ US$ 483 million
- Captain Marvel ≈ US$ 456 million
- Star Wars: The Last Jedi ≈ US$ 451 million
- Doctor Strange in the Multiverse of Madness ≈ US$ 450 million
A Massive Thanksgiving Domestically for Disney, Even Without the Record
In North America, Zootopia 2 is projected to earn $135M–$150M across its first five days over the Thanksgiving holiday. While that won’t dethrone the all-time Thanksgiving champion (Moana 2, with $225M over five days), Zootopia 2 will still join the upper ranks alongside:
- Frozen II – $125M (five-day)
- The Hunger Games: Catching Fire – $109M (five-day)
Even more importantly, industry insiders believe these early projections may be conservative. Strong walk-up business, family turnout, and a wave of glowing reviews could push Zootopia 2 even higher by Sunday.
China Pushes the Zootopia Sequel Into Mega-Hit Territory
Where Zootopia 2 truly takes off is overseas, specifically in China, where the original film remains a beloved cultural phenomenon.
The sequel is generating extraordinary momentum:
- ¥250M ($35M) opening day expected
- ¥1.6B+ ($225M+) projected for the five-day launch
- Record-breaking pre-sales for an animated release
- Overwhelmingly positive early audience reactions
China alone could contribute over $225M of the global opening, fueling an overseas weekend expected to exceed $375M+.
